      <description>&lt;P&gt;Dynatrace captures SQL text thru the JDBC driver within the application tier.   I assume you're referring to the TNS Listener that runs (normally) on the Database server.  I don't believe the TNS Listener uses JDBC and therefore Dynatrace will not automatically capture the SQL text when database connections are initiated thru the TNS listener.&lt;/P&gt;</description>
